Leslie Jordan passed away on Monday after a motorcar collision, Jordan’s representative confirmed to the media. He was 67.
The renowned comic star was going to Hollywood when it was later presumed, he suffered some kind of medical crisis and slammed his BMW car into the flank of a construction.
The “American Horror Story” head was also known for his profession in “Will & Grace,” “Hearts Afire” and “Call Me Kat.”
Jordan’s celebrity zoomed in on the pandemic when he evolved a viral social media celebrity for his touching and comedic clips. He eventually increased his Instagram followership from 50,000 to 5.8 million, where it stands presently.
A candidly gay celebrity, Jordan kidded to the media that he learned he was homosexual “since childbirth.”
Throughout his profession, Jordan also frankly discussed his significant misuse problems and the DUI that acted as his rock bottom before reaching sober.
